When Is the Right Time to Get Life Insurance?

Life insurance is a critical component of a comprehensive financial plan, but knowing when to get it can feel overwhelming. Whether you’re single, married, or nearing retirement, securing a policy provides peace of mind for you and your loved ones. Let’s explore the essential stages of life and how they correlate with choosing the right timing for life insurance.

Understanding Life Insurance Needs at Different Life Stages

Life insurance needs can change significantly as you move through different stages of life, making it important to reassess your coverage regularly.

1. Consider Life Insurance as a Young Adult

If you find yourself in your twenties or thirties, you may think life insurance is a distant concern. However, the reality is that purchasing a term life insurance policy now can offer benefits beyond just covering funeral expenses. Did you know that student loan debt doesn’t automatically disappear after death? Should something happen to you, those loans could become a burden on your parents or co-signers. A policy can help ease this financial strain.

2. The Importance of Coverage for Newlyweds

Entering marriage is a beautiful celebration; however, it also comes with shared financial responsibilities. If you or your spouse were to pass away, the surviving partner could face significant challenges. This is where term life insurance proves invaluable. Starting at just $8 a month, a policy can safeguard your household’s lifestyle by covering ongoing expenses like the mortgage and utility bills.

3. Protecting Your Family with Life Insurance

Having children shifts priorities dramatically. Your family’s well-being now hinges on your ability to provide for them. This is a crucial time to consider getting life insurance. Picture your family without your support: Can they afford college tuition or maintain their current lifestyle? An Accumulator Universal Life Insurance policy can not only offer coverage but also build cash value over time, which can be tapped into when needed.

4. Preparing for Retirement

As you approach retirement, the reasons for getting life insurance may evolve. With children becoming independent, you might think your obligations have lessened, but preserving your retirement plans becomes more critical. Life insurance can replace employer benefits you may have lost. Opting for a Lifetime Universal Life Insurance policy allows you to customize coverage and secure locked-in rates, ensuring you have the protection necessary for your golden years.

5. For Seniors: Leaving a Legacy

For those between the ages of 65 and 85, life insurance can be a powerful tool for leaving a legacy. You might want to provide an inheritance for your descendants or cover expenses like estate taxes. A Guaranteed Issue Whole Life option offers a straightforward way to tackle final expenses while ensuring that your estate is preserved for heirs.

Factors to Consider When Purchasing Life Insurance

When purchasing life insurance, it’s important to consider several key factors to ensure the policy aligns with your financial goals and family needs.

Your Health Matters

One of the most significant factors influencing your premium is your health at the time you apply. Think of your policy as a snapshot of you on that day. If you’re in good health now, you’ll likely have lower rates compared to if you wait until you encounter health issues. Just as you wouldn’t buy a car with a flat tire, why buy insurance when your health isn’t at its peak?

Age: Locking in Your Premiums

Your age plays a pivotal role in your premiums, and it’s not getting any younger! Securing a policy while you’re younger and healthier can mean paying significantly less overtime. Remember, rates can rise as you age. Ensuring you have a solid plan in place now could save you money in the long run.

Exploring Insurance Options

There’s no “one size fits all” approach to life insurance. Depending on your circumstances, you may be interested in terms that last for a fixed period or whole life policies that last for your entire lifetime. Comparison shopping can reveal favorable options tailored to your unique needs. Consider working with a knowledgeable agent who can assist you in assessing your requirements.

  • Term life insurance — Ideal for covering specific financial obligations.
  • Whole life insurance — Builds cash value and lasts a lifetime.
  • Universal life insurance — Offers flexibility and investment opportunities.
